Montana Mustang Columbian Arabic Coffee is a 12 oz ground coffee made from high-quality Colombian Arabica beans, medium-roasted for a balanced flavor profile with notes of caramel and nuts. Packaged in a rustic burlap bag, this coffee not only delivers exceptional taste but also reflects a commitment to ethical sourcing and environmental sustainability.
